This paper proposes a new method for personal identity verification based the analysis of face images applying One Class Support Vector Machines. This is a recently introduced kernel method to build a unary classifier to be trained by using only positive examples, avoiding the sensible choice of the impostor set typical of standard binary Support Vector Machines. The features of this classifier and the application to face-based identity verification are described and an implementation presented. Several experiments have been performed on both standard and proprietary databases. The tests performed, also in comparison with a standard classifier built on Support Vector Machines, clearly show the potential of the proposed approach.
